Introduction au Terminal et au Shell Python
Cette leçon couvre les bases du terminal, du shell Bash et du shell Python, expliquant comment ils fonctionnent ensemble pour exécuter des commandes et manipuler le système.
Introduction







Logique de contrôle de flux














Types avancés










Les fonctions










Créer un programme complet : explorateur d'historique web
Ecosystème autour de Python







La programmation orientée objet en Python







Détails de la leçon
Description de la leçon
Dans cette leçon, nous explorons les concepts fondamentaux du terminal et du shell. Le terminal est un logiciel permettant d'interagir avec le système à travers des lignes de commande. Le shell, quant à lui, est un interpréteur de commandes s'exécutant à l'intérieur du terminal. Le shell Bash est couramment utilisé sous Linux, tandis que le shell CMD est utilisé sous Windows. Nous aborderons également le shell Python qui permet d'exécuter des commandes Python directement à partir du terminal. Cette leçon inclut des démonstrations pratiques pour lancer des commandes simples, afficher des résultats et manipuler des objets via des instructions et des mots-clés. Nos exemples utilisent Python 3.5, mais d'autres versions comme Python 3.4 ou 3.6 sont aussi compatibles.
Objectifs de cette leçon
Les objectifs de cette vidéo sont :
- Comprendre les concepts de base du terminal et du shell.
- Savoir lancer et utiliser Bash et Python en ligne de commande.
- Écrire et exécuter des commandes simples en Python.
Prérequis pour cette leçon
Pour suivre cette vidéo, il est recommandé d'avoir :
- Une connaissance de base de l'informatique.
- Avoir un système Linux installé.
Métiers concernés
Cette formation est particulièrement utile pour :
- Les administrateurs systèmes et réseaux.
- Les développeurs logiciels travaillant sous Linux.
- Les ingénieurs de données et les scientifiques des données.
Alternatives et ressources
Les alternatives aux shells mentionnés incluent :
- Zsh pour une alternative à Bash.
- PowerShell pour une alternative à CMD sous Windows.
- iPython pour une alternative au shell Python standard.
Questions & Réponses
